Abstract:
The present invention provides a polymer composition for producing a liquid crystal alignment film, with which a high-quality liquid crystal alignment film can be efficiently produced by expanding the range of light irradiation level at which alignment control capability is stably obtained. More specifically, the present invention provides a composition for producing a liquid crystal alignment film for a lateral field driving-type liquid crystal display element. The present invention also provides a liquid crystal alignment agent and a liquid crystal alignment film that are formed of the composition, and a substrate and liquid crystal display element having the liquid crystal alignment film. The polymer composition according to the present invention contains: (A) at least two polymers having a structure providing photoreactivity and a structure providing liquid crystallinity; (B) a polymer produced using a diamine compound and at least one selected from diisocyanate components and tetracarboxylic acid derivatives; and (C) an organic solvent, wherein, in particular, of the at least two polymers, one of the polymers (A1) and the other one of the polymers (A2) have different amounts of the structure providing photoreactivity.
